SSY Group (HKG:2005) Will Pay A Smaller Dividend Than Last Year
SSY Group Limited (HKG:2005) is reducing its dividend from last year's comparable payment to HK$0.05 on the 26th of September. The yield is still above the industry average at 6.2%.
SSY Group's Projected Earnings Seem Likely To Cover Future Distributions
Impressive dividend yields are good, but this doesn't matter much if the payments can't be sustained. Based on the last payment, SSY Group's earnings were much higher than the dividend, but it wasn't converting those earnings into cash flow. In general, we consider cash flow to be more important than earnings, so we would be cautious about relying on the sustainability of this dividend.
Over the next year, EPS is forecast to expand by 101.6%. Assuming the dividend continues along recent trends, we think the payout ratio could be 36% by next year, which is in a pretty sustainable range.

SSY Group Has A Solid Track Record
The company has been paying a dividend for a long time, and it has been quite stable which gives us confidence in the future dividend potential. Since 2015, the dividend has gone from HK$0.025 total annually to HK$0.175. This implies that the company grew its distributions at a yearly rate of about 21% over that duration. It is good to see that there has been strong dividend growth, and that there haven't been any cuts for a long time.
SSY Group May Find It Hard To Grow The Dividend
The company's investors will be pleased to have been receiving dividend income for some time. Let's not jump to conclusions as things might not be as good as they appear on the surface. In the last five years, SSY Group's earnings per share has shrunk at approximately 4.0% per annum. If earnings continue declining, the company may have to make the difficult choice of reducing the dividend or even stopping it completely - the opposite of dividend growth. It's not all bad news though, as the earnings are predicted to rise over the next 12 months - we would just be a bit cautious until this can turn into a longer term trend.
In Summary
Overall, it's not great to see that the dividend has been cut, but this might be explained by the payments being a bit high previously. While the low payout ratio is a redeeming feature, this is offset by the minimal cash to cover the payments. Overall, we don't think this company has the makings of a good income stock.
